Werfen is a global leader in specialized diagnostics, founded in 1966 in Barcelona, Spain. The company operates in 30 countries and over 100 territories, with a focus on Hemostasis, Acute Care Diagnostics, Transfusion, Autoimmunity, and Transplant. Werfen's success stems from its commitment to innovation, quality, and customer satisfaction. They offer various job opportunities, including a position in Orangeburg, NY, which involves basic filling, packaging, and formulation tasks for Coagulation, Clinical Chemistry, and Critical Care product lines. The role requires maintaining clean production areas, completing work orders accurately, and adhering to safety policies. The hourly wage range is $20 to $23, based on factors like education, experience, and specific business needs.

Werfen is a global leader in specialized diagnostics, founded in 1966 in Barcelona, Spain. The company operates in 30 countries and over 100 territories, with a workforce of more than 7,000. Werfen specializes in Hemostasis, Acute Care Diagnostics, Transfusion, Autoimmunity, and Transplant. They offer Original Equipment Manufacturing (OEM) services, researching, developing, and manufacturing customized assays and biomaterials. The company is committed to innovation, quality, and customer satisfaction, providing healthcare professionals with valuable solutions to improve hospital efficiency and patient care. The job posting is for a Clinical Chemistry, Critical Care, Coagulation, and/or Microbiology position, requiring a B.S./B.A. in Science or Medical Technology, plus 2 years of clinical laboratory experience. The hourly wage range is $24 to $29.
